DAKAR (Reuters) – A Delta Airlines Boeing 767 airplane sure for New York made an emergency cease on account of a technical incident at Senegal’s Blaise Diagne International Airport, the West African nation’s transport ministry mentioned.
The pilot managed to cease the airplane, which was carrying 216 passengers, safely and no accidents have been reported, the ministry mentioned in a press release.
“During take-off, the plane carried out an acceleration maneuver adopted by emergency braking on account of a technical incident,” the word reads.
The crash got here a day after the US Federal Aviation Administration mentioned it might open a brand new security evaluate into Boeing following an in-flight emergency in January.
Senegal’s nationwide civil aviation company and its Bureau of Investigation and Analysis will examine the crash, he mentioned.
